Output 8ecdc0f419d57bfbb501364b93d24e486116dc6423f58918ea6e0f4e45593c27:15

value
2925102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7af7e0c4a108fd6bf7da3aa2d2f7ca271fe79be OP_EQUAL
address
3MMTSDCz3XVkSLqKMBpF67pNo88UrHHBLx
transaction
8ecdc0f419d57bfbb501364b93d24e486116dc6423f58918ea6e0f4e45593c27